Gabon international,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ang, has thrown his support behind the Super Eagles of Nigeria ahead of their World Cup opener against Croatia on June 16, saying that he wants to see Eagles’ star Alex Iwobi succeed in Russia, AOIFootball.com reported.

Aubameyang, who is teammate to Alex Iwobi at Arsenal, further pleaded with the Iwobi to bring him a pair of Nigeria’s new jersey when he returns after a successful World Cup outing.

“I support Nigeria for World Cup because of my friend Alex Iwobi, but to tell the truth also because of your @nikefootball kit need one,” Aubameyang twitted.

Super Eagles were drawn in Group D of the World Cup and will open their campaign with a tough test against a star-studded Croatian team on June 16, before facing debutants, Iceland five days later.

The team will then fly to St. Petersburg on the 26th to face familiar foes, Argentina in their last group game.
